Red Storm: A Play in Three Acts
Illus. with photos. Peking: Foreign Languages Press, 1965. 8vo. Cloth-backed boards. 115 p. Fine in near fine d.w. with a couple of short tears at top edge. [62268]
According to the dust wrapper blurb this play, "drawing its theme from the February 7, 1923 strike, a great event in the annals of China's working-class movement, tells how the Peking-Hankow Railway Workers, led by the Chinese Communist Party, fought against their oppression by imperialists and warlords"
